Teenager escapes police custody - by getting out of a parked police car

Don’t worry though, he poses no risk to the public.

POLICE IN NORTHERN Ireland have started a manhunt for a teenage boy who has escaped custody.

The 15 year old got out of a parked police car in the Glenshane Road area at about 4.25pm today.

The PSNI said he is wearing a grey tracksuit and black shoes.

Although they say he poses no risk to the public, they are continuing to conduct searches in the Dungiven area.
